Payet can go, say West Ham

  • by Staff Writer
  • Monday, 16th January 2017

West Ham United are willing to sell Dimitri Payet - but not until Marseille make a suitable offer.

Earlier today KUMB.com revealed that representatives from West Ham and Marseille, who flew in from France this morning, had met to discuss the possibility of the French international returning to Ligue 1.

The Marseille party, who were represented by Club President Jacques-Henri Eyraud and Sporting Director Andoni Zubizarreta were joined by Payet's agent Jacques-Olivier Auguste.

It is understood that no fresh offer was made, although L'OM were instructed to return with an improved offer closer to West Ham's valuation if their intentions were serious.




The only bid made by Marseille so far, according to L'Equipe, was their opening gambit of €22million, with a further €3million to follow dependent on various clauses being met.

West Ham - who stated previously they have no intention of selling Payet - will hold out for circa £35million for their star asset, who recently revealed his desire to leave London due to personal issues.
